I am attempting to find out whether the following persons are related and how they are related. I have tried looking into Family Search and could not find anything that would connect these two persons.

1. Ciro Figlia: Born 10 September 1876/77 in Mezzojuso, provincia Palermo. Date of Death: August 9, 1941, New York City. He was married to Francesca Monastero, Year of birth: 1884, Villafrati, provincia Palermo. Death:
October 4, 1952, New York City.

AND

2. Giuseppe Figlia, Date of Birth: 15 January, 1870, in Mezzojuso, provincia Palermo. Died: 14 September, 1955 in Kansas City, Missouri. He was married to Marianna Campione, Date of Birth: 14 October, 1870. Died 13 Febraury, 1944, Kansas City, Missouri.

I have also reached a brick wall with regard to finding the parents of Ciro Figlia. If I could get some assistance with the above, I would very much appreciate it. Generally the same surname in a particular town indicates branches of the same family. The neighboring towns would most often have different surnames (with a couple of possible exceptions). Same in my grandparent's town near Rome. There are at least 2 surnames that are in BOTH of their branches -- apparently distant cousins from the same families. It's not uncommon as most towns were independent of each other & their citizens rarely mixed...

:!: According to Ciro's birth act, his father Angelo was age 40.

Here is a POSSIBLE birth act for Angelo in 1835 (#62)
Father Pietro Figlia
Mother Tommasa di Carlo
http://dl.antenati.san.beniculturali.it ... 6.jpg.html


And at Giuseppe's birth, his father Salvatore was age 30.
Here is a POSSIBLE birth for Salvatore in 1838 (#62)
Father Pietro Figlia
Mother Tommasa di Carlo
